1. Skid shoes are stored in the hardware bag for
shipping.
2. Remove from hardware bag, and install skid shoes
using the provided fasteners
3. Insert the fasteners so the at head of the carriage
bolt is toward the outside of the main housing.
CAUTION: Check the skids to ensure that the auger does
not contact the paved or gravel surface. Adjust skids as
necessary to make up for wear on the snow blower.
1. Check the re pressure to ensure the res are
properly inated.
2. Move skid shoes up and down to the desired posion
based on the surface texture.
If the surface is rougher adjust the skid shoes lower.
If the surfaces is smoother adjust the skid shoes
higher. Firmly ghten the nuts that secure both skids

1. Fill the engine with SAE 5W-30 engine oil. Fill the
engine with 1.2 to 1.5 quarts of oil. Fill up to the full
level mark on the dip sck.
2. Check that the fuel lter is clean and ll the tank with
unleaded gasoline.
Do not add fuel while the engine is
running or is hot. Keep open ames, sparks, and heat
away from the fuel and store fuel in containers
specically designed for that purpose.
Manually push the snow blower
away from the spill and wipe up immediately.
